Ibexa Admin UI vulnerable to DOM-based Cross-site Scripting in file upload widget

Impact

The file upload widget is vulnerable to XSS payloads in filenames. Access permission to upload files is required. As such, in most cases only authenticated editors and administrators will have the required permission. It is not persistent, i.e. the payload is only executed during the upload. In effect, an attacker will have to trick an editor/administrator into uploading a strangely named file. The fix ensures XSS is escaped.

Patches

See "Patched versions". Commit: https://github.com/ibexa/admin-ui/commit/8dc413fad1045fcfbe65dbcb0bea8516accc4c3e
